How To Choose The Best Backpacks For Moms
Not all diaper backpacks are created equal. Some prioritize looks over utility, while others overload you with pockets that don’t actually help. Focus on these three deciding factors to find a bag that works with your routine, not against it.
Pocket Architecture and Access
A great mom backpack has a dedicated parent pocket (usually hidden against your back) for your phone and keys, plus at least two insulated bottle pockets that can handle wide 11-ounce bottles. Look for a separate wet/dry compartment—this keeps soiled clothes or a leaky sippy cup from ruining everything else in the bag.
Carry Comfort and Load Distribution
When a backpack is fully loaded with diapers, wipes, bottles, a change of clothes, and snacks, it can easily exceed ten pounds. Padded, ergonomic shoulder straps and a cushioned back panel prevent digging and discomfort during long walks through the zoo or airport terminals. A luggage sleeve on the back is a lifesaver for travel.
Material Durability and Cleanability
Spills, crumbs, and diaper blowouts are inevitable. Choose water-resistant nylon or polyester that wipes clean with a damp cloth. Avoid rough fabrics that stain easily. Reinforced stitching and smooth zippers that don’t snag are signs of a bag that will last through multiple kids.

1. RUVALINO Diaper Bag Backpack
With over a million units sold, the RUVALINO is the most battle-tested diaper backpack on this list. Its lightweight yet waterproof fabric resists deformation and tearing far better than standard twill polyester bags. The extra-wide opening and dual-zipper design let you grab a diaper or snack one-handed—critical when you’re holding a wriggling baby.
The interior is intelligently laid out: a padded laptop pocket sits behind mesh organizers, while two insulated pockets comfortably hold bottles from 5 to 11 ounces. A dedicated mommy pocket hides your phone and wallet, and the included changing pad has its own storage slot. Reviewers consistently report this bag lasting through multiple kids without zipper failures or fabric wear.
At 25 liters, it’s not the absolute largest bag here, but its smart compartmentalization makes it feel roomier. The gender-neutral austere gray finish means it doesn’t scream “diaper bag,” blending seamlessly as a travel or work backpack after the baby years.

2. miss fong Leather Diaper Bag Tote
This miss fong tote is for the mom who refuses to sacrifice style for practicality. Made from 100% PU leather with a waterproof nylon lining, it resists stains and wipes clean with a damp towel. The structured silhouette and tasseled zipper pulls give it a refined look that doubles as a purse—no one will guess it’s packed with diapers and onesies.
It converts between a backpack (using the adjustable strap) and a top-handle tote, plus includes stroller clips for hands-free strolling. The magnetic back pocket doubles as a luggage sleeve, making airport travel smoother. Inside, you get two large insulated pockets for bottles and food, plus a keychain clip so you never lose your keys at the bottom.
The trade-off is weight: at 2.75 pounds empty, it’s heavier than nylon competitors. But for moms who want a bag that transitions from the playground to dinner without looking out of place, this is a strong contender. The 27 x 17.3-inch changing pad is one of the largest included with any bag on this list.

3. Itzy Ritzy Mini Diaper Bag Backpack
The Itzy Ritzy Mini Plus is engineered for quick trips where you don’t need to pack for a week-long excursion. Its compact footprint (13.75 x 12.5 x 9 inches) fits neatly under a stroller or on a café chair, yet it still holds a full diaper-change kit plus a parent’s essentials. The vegan leather exterior feels premium to the touch and wipes clean instantly.
Ten thoughtfully placed pockets include a dedicated parent pocket with a key lanyard, two bottle pockets on the sides, and a hidden back compartment that stores the included easy-wipe changing pad. Full-length zippers allow the bag to open clamshell-style, giving you a full view of everything inside without items spilling out. Braided rubber feet on the bottom keep the bag upright and protect the material from ground grime.
This bag shines for moms of older infants and toddlers who only need a few diapers, snacks, and a sippy cup. The adjustable shoulder straps work well for plus-size parents, and the unisex leopard pattern gets consistent compliments. Note that it doesn’t include stroller clips or insulated bottle pockets—plan accordingly for hot days.

4. Wrangler Aztec Backpack
Wrangler brings its heritage of durable craftsmanship to this Aztec diaper backpack, built from robust canvas that stands up to daily abuse. The medium-weight fabric resists punctures and looks better with age, while the southwestern-inspired color palette (Angel Coffee) adds a distinctive style that stands apart from standard black or gray options.
Three insulated pockets are a standout feature for bottle-fed babies—you can prep and carry three bottles without worrying about temperature. The stroller strap attaches securely to most handles, and the padded shoulder straps distribute weight comfortably. A hidden back zip pocket is perfect for stashing your wallet securely against your body, a detail many moms in reviews specifically praise.
The 16.5 x 11.5 x 6-inch dimensions make it slim enough to wear without feeling bulky, yet spacious enough for a full diaper change kit plus parent items. Some reviewers note that the front bottle pockets don’t accommodate wider bottles like Boon Nursh, but they work well for standard 5- to 8-ounce bottles or as extra storage for sunscreen and hand sanitizer.

5. LOVEVOOK Diaper Bag Backpack
If you need to carry everything for two kids, the LOVEVOOK is your bag. With a 30-liter capacity spread across 20 pockets, you can pack diapers for both children, a full change of clothes, snacks, toys, and still have room for a 15.6-inch laptop and an 11-inch tablet. The tear-resistant, water-resistant nylon fabric shrugs off light rain and accidental spills.
Two insulated bottle pockets accommodate wide or tall bottles up to 11 ounces, and elastic side pockets keep wipes and smaller items within reach. The included changing pad (23.5 x 14.5 inches) folds up neatly and is easy to wipe clean. Double zippers allow one-handed opening, and luggage straps on the back slide over your suitcase handle for travel days.
The main downside is weight: when fully loaded, this bag gets heavy. The padded back panel and cushioned shoulder straps help distribute the load, but it’s noticeably bulkier than more compact options. For moms who prioritize carrying capacity above all else and don’t mind a bit of heft, this is an exceptional value.

6. MOMUVO Quilted Diaper Bag Backpack
The MOMUVO quilted diaper bag delivers impressive storage at a very accessible price point. Its 30-liter main compartment fits everything for a full day out, and the 20 pockets include thoughtful touches like a hidden mommy pocket, a back anti-theft pocket, and a separate waterproof section for wet or soiled items. The quilted exterior pattern gives it a modern, soft look.
Two insulated bottle pockets handle bottles from 5 to 11 ounces, and built-in stroller straps let you clip the bag directly onto your stroller frame. A 15.6-inch padded laptop pocket and a 12.9-inch iPad pocket sit inside the main compartment, making it functional for work or travel. The luggage sleeve on the back is a bonus for airport runs. Reviewers consistently note that this bag holds up for two to three years of regular use without ripping or zipper failure.
The weight is a featherlight 11 ounces empty, which is remarkable for a bag this size. The water-resistant polyester fabric cleans easily with a damp cloth. The included changing pad (26 x 14 inches) folds flat with a zipper compartment for diaper cream, plus flaps for wipes and diapers. This is an ideal entry-level bag for new parents who want maximum function without a big investment.

7. mommores Diaper Bag Backpack
The mommores diaper bag is built for parents who demand organization above all else. Its front section features three insulated bottle pockets (fitting 5 to 11 ounces) plus a dedicated wet/dry pocket, so you can separate clean diapers from soiled ones instantly. A separate, zippered diaper compartment attaches to the main bag, giving you quick access to changes without disturbing the main contents.
The medium-weight Oxford polyester fabric is water-resistant and lined with an easy-clean interior. Reinforced stitching and smooth zippers add to the durability, and the padded shoulder straps reduce pressure during long carries. An expandable zipper on the main compartment provides extra room when you need to stash a jacket or a larger toy. The stroller clips and luggage strap make it versatile for any outing.
Reviewers with twins or two close-age kids particularly praise this bag’s capacity and layout. It holds clothes, diapers, wipes, bottles, and snacks for two without feeling overstuffed. The only common complaint is that the bottle pockets are stiff and don’t easily accommodate very wide bottles. For daily use with siblings, this is a smart, well-executed choice.
